Google asks this during the Onsite to assess your architectural thinking. They want to see how you decompose a complex problem, choose appropriate technologies, and reason about failure modes. Strong candidates proactively discuss monitoring, alerting, and operational concerns.

What the Interviewer Expects
  • Systematically gather requirements and estimate capacity (QPS, storage, bandwidth)
  • Design a scalable architecture with clear component responsibilities
  • Make well-reasoned database and caching decisions with trade-off analysis
  • Address consistency vs availability trade-offs specific to the use case
  • Discuss partitioning strategy, replication, and data modeling
  • Cover failure handling, monitoring, and alerting strategies

How to Approach This
  1. Start by clarifying functional and non-functional requirements with the interviewer.
  2. Estimate the scale: QPS, storage, bandwidth. This drives your design decisions.
  3. Draw a high-level architecture first, then deep dive into 1-2 critical components.
  4. Discuss trade-offs explicitly (e.g., consistency vs availability, SQL vs NoSQL).
  5. Address failure scenarios, monitoring, and how the system handles 10x traffic spikes.
